Dripping
Inside me is a void
Begging to be filled.
And you are like water,
Splashing around my ribcage until
I overflow.
You spill past my lips and
Flow down my body and
Crash at my feet and
Stream away as quickly as you came.
You leave me shaking and weeping,
Scared to look and see you leaving,
Scrambling for another fix and then
You return and pour
Down my throat and
Through my veins and
Out through my fingertips,
Dripping through the cracks in the floor and
Putting me right back where I started again.
